Koshish Chhetri

Koshish Chhetri is singer, song writer and actor. At a young age of 7, Koshish was pushed to perform on the stage for the first time. ‘Rudai Chhin Aama’ was his first recording that established him as a child singer. After modeling for his own music video titled ‘Daiva Ko Ris’, Koshish became successful in establishing himself as an actor. This versatile personality secured his first movie role in 2014. He won the CG Kamana Film Award for best debut actor, Nepal Film Critics Award for best actor and Sixth Cine Award under the public choice category for his performance in the movie “Mokshya”. His second movie is ‘Parva’. His second movie ‘Parva’ was a critical and commercial success. He is also the man behind the lyrics and music of the hit song ‘Kale Dai’.

Maotse Gurung

Maotse Gurung is a talented Nepali actor, writer, and director from Pokhara. He has made significant contributions to the Nepali film industry and is known for his remarkable performances in various movies. Some of his notable works include: Daya Rani (2024): in this film maotse work as a director. Manko Babari (2017): In this film, Maotse Gurung played a key role as a writer. Shirsuba (2020): Another project where he showcased his writing skills. Purano Dunga (2016): Maotse Gurung’s involvement in this film further highlights his versatility as an actor and writer. His filmography extends beyond these, with roles in other movies such as “Dimag Kharab”, “Jai Ho”, and “Kabaddi”. Maotse Gurung’s talent and dedication have left a lasting impact on the Nepali cinema scene.

Jiwan Luitel

Jiwan Luitel (born 10 September 1981, Morang, Nepal) is a leading Nepali actor and former Mr. Nepal 2002, active in cinema since the early 2000s. He made his film debut with Tirkha (2008) and has since appeared in 65+ Nepali feature films, becoming one of Kollywood’s most prolific mainstream actors. Known for romantic and dramatic roles, Luitel earned the KTV Best Debutant Actor Award for Nasib Aafno (2010) and won Best Actor at the NFDC National Film Awards (2069) for Malati Ko Bhatti (2012). His career also includes modeling highlights such as the Sydney Fashion Show (2009) and a widely reported stunt injury the same year.

Rajaram Poudel

Rajaram Poudel, born on December 30, 1956, in Kathmandu, Nepal, is a distinguished Nepalese actor and comedian. He embarked on his acting journey in 1982 and has since contributed to over a hundred Nepali films and television series. ​ Throughout his extensive career, Poudel has portrayed a variety of roles, showcasing his versatility and depth as an actor. Some of his notable film credits include:​ Basanti (2000): Portrayed the character Pandit. ​ Ma Yesto Geet Gaauchu (2017): Delivered a memorable performance that resonated with audiences. ​ Yatra: A Musical Vlog (2019): Further showcased his acting prowess. ​ In addition to his film work, Poudel has made significant contributions to Nepali television. He is well-known for his role as Thulo Buwa in the long-running comedy series Jire Khursani (2003–2015) and as Leader in Brake Fail (2016–2018). ​ His dedication to the arts has been recognized with several accolades, including the Bhairab Genius Award in 2020.
